What Is an HbA1c Test?

The HbA1c test, also called the A1c test, glycated hemoglobin test, or glycosylated hemoglobin test, measures the percentage of hemoglobin that has glucose attached to it.

Unlike a random or fasting blood sugar test, HbA1c gives an estimate of average blood glucose over the previous two to three months. This makes it useful for detecting diabetes and monitoring long-term blood sugar control.

Doctors may recommend this test when they:

  • Screen for diabetes or prediabetes.
  • Monitor an existing diabetes diagnosis.
  • Assess long-term blood sugar control.
  • Review whether a treatment plan is working.
  • Investigate consistently high blood glucose readings.

Does the HbA1c Test Require Fasting?

No. HbA1c testing normally does not require fasting.

You can generally eat and drink normally before the test. This differs from some glucose tests that require fasting for a specified period.

However, if your doctor has ordered HbA1c together with other tests, such as fasting blood glucose or a lipid profile, you may need to follow additional preparation instructions.

Always follow the instructions provided by your doctor or laboratory.

HbA1c Normal Range

HbA1c results are reported as a percentage.

Commonly used categories are:

  • Below 5.7%: Generally considered normal.
  • 5.7% to 6.4%: Generally considered the prediabetes range.
  • 6.5% or higher: May indicate diabetes and requires appropriate clinical assessment and confirmation.

The result should not be interpreted in isolation. A healthcare professional should consider symptoms, medical history, other glucose tests, and possible conditions that can affect HbA1c.

What Can Affect HbA1c Results?

HbA1c is useful, but it does not always tell the complete story.

Certain conditions can affect the accuracy or interpretation of the result. These may include some forms of anemia, changes in red blood cell lifespan, certain blood disorders, kidney disease, recent blood loss, or blood transfusion.

For this reason, tell your doctor about relevant medical conditions and treatments before interpreting an unexpected HbA1c result.

How Often Should HbA1c Be Tested?

Testing frequency depends on the person's health status and treatment plan.

People with diabetes may need periodic HbA1c testing to monitor glucose control. People without diabetes may need testing when a doctor identifies risk factors or symptoms.

The correct interval depends on individual circumstances. A doctor can recommend an appropriate testing schedule based on previous results and overall health.
